Blood Stab
The blood, boobs and werewolves that "Psycho" always needed...
If not available, try switching to another server.
Overview
An ill-fated prank forces an innocent couple to face seriously dark consequences in a heavy metal infused iteration of Hitchcock's most infamous scene.
Status: Released
February 15, 20207m
Budget: $276
Share:
Top Billed Cast:
Images:






